Free Tax Preparation and Filing Resources

Free File is a federal income tax preparation and electronic filing program which allows eligible taxpayers to prepare and file their taxes for free. The tax preparation software is developed through a partnership between the Internal Revenue Service (IRS) and the Free File Alliance, a group of private sector tax software companies.

You may access free commercial online tax preparation and electronic filing services through www.IRS.gov/freefile.

Eligible taxpayers may prepare and file their federal income tax returns for free using commercial online software provided by the Free File Alliance companies.

Since Free File’s debut in 2003, more than 56 million returns have been filed for free through the Free File program, saving taxpayers millions of dollars.

SVDP Helped Me Restructure my 700% PayDay Loan

image.jpg

As a single mom with a family, I loved my job and it paid well. Yet, my finances were in disarray.  I was behind on paying my utility bills, car loan and rent.  Surely, a PayDay Loan was a quick and easy fix to my financial struggles! 

My bills continued to pile up!  I saw no end to my financial problems.   I reached out to the Society of St. Vincent de Paul (SVdP) for help.  On my first visit with volunteer advocates, I saw I had a chance to get back on my feet again !

Yet, my PayDay Loan, with an interest rate 700%, kept me trapped in a cycle of debt!  Then, my volunteer advocates introduced me to SVdP Mini-Loan Program (MLP)  as a way to help me take control of my finances.  While reviewing my bank statements and budget with my volunteer advocates, I became more knowledgeable of unwise financial decisions I had made over time. 

MLP-500px.png

During additional meetings, I set up a budget with the help of MLP Coordinator and encouragement of my volunteer advocates.  The key point of these meetings was to set up a budget I would stick to.  I needed to be truthful to myself and to understand all my finances, both income and expenses. With confidence, I applied for a low interest bank loan available through the Mini-Loan program.  Shortly thereafter, I was approved.  YEAH!

Now the difficult part started.  I had to stay on budget!  My SVdP volunteer advocates helped me.   Together, we reviewed my budget periodically, addressed other obligations, and established written goals.  They gave me a reality check on how loans are obtained. And, most importantly, they kept my feet to the fire to ensure my budget goals were met.

I was comfortable and very proud I was managing my finances.  By year end, all my bills were current.  My only debt was the MLP loan which was being paid on schedule.  I established a “credit builder account” with a credit union to increase my FICO score and help me with future goals.   Within sixteen months, I paid off the MLP loan, raised my FICO score from 545 to 670, and had cash in the bank! 

I have no doubt my volunteer advocates were sent by God!

Prayer to St Vincent de Paul

Vincent_de_Paul.PNG

St Vincent de Paul (1581 – 1660)

PRAYER TO ST. VINCENT DE PAUL

O Saint Vincent de Paul, our father and model, throughout your life you wished to imitate Jesus, the missionary and servant. In your time, you confronted the plague, the illness of the people. Intercede now with the Holy Trinity on behalf of all the nations on earth visited by the modern scourge. Help the bodies and hearts of all victims. Strengthen caregivers, be close to all neighbors, and enlighten researchers. Walk with those approaching the portals of death.

***

As you gave strong and ardent advice to struggle against evil, so now come to our aid! Teach us how to expose our lives for the weakest among us, and strengthen us to help them better in fearless perseverance. With the sole desire of aiding them in their needs, open our spirits to God’s infinite providence. Let us endow it with his total will for action. Inspire in us, also, obedience to our leaders, as we now place ourselves in your hands, confident and fortified with genuine feelings of dedication and zeal for our sisters and brothers.

AMEN

2019 Friends of the Poor Walk

September 28th, 2019 

Please join us on Saturday morning, September 28th, for a beautiful walk at Phillip Creek Trails. All proceeds from our walk go directly to benefit those in need in the Frisco area.

walk

In 2017, St Vincent de Paul provided more than $132,000 in housing assistance, food, clothing, transportation, utility costs and medicine to those in the Frisco area. In addition, our members volunteered more than 6,800 hours in serving the poor and providing educational and advocacy support to promote self-sufficiency.
